Our Research Facilities

We provide facilities conducive to a world-leading education and research environment, with our laboratory facilities benefitting from £1.38M investment (2014-2020).

Our laboratories and facilties include the Hydraulics Laboratory (in the School of Engineering); various facilities in the Roxby Building and the Higher Education Academy’s 2016 Collaborative Award for Teaching Excellence (CATE) winning Central Teaching Laboratory where we embed ‘research-led’ science as fundamental to our learning program.
